phpMyAdmin 拒绝访问的原因及解决方案:认证失败:检查用户名和密码是否正确。服务器配置错误:调整防火墙设置,检查数据库端口是否正确。权限问题:授予用户对数据库的访问权限。会话超时:刷新浏览器页面重新连接。phpMyAdmin 配置错误:检查配置文件和文件权限,确保启用了必需的 Apache 模块。服务器问题:等待一段时间后再重试或联系主机提供商。
为什么 phpMyAdmin 拒绝访问?
phpMyAdmin 是一个流行的 MySQL 数据库管理工具,但有时可能会遇到拒绝访问的情况。以下是导致此问题的常见原因以及相应的解决方案:
1. 认证失败
-
错误:登录时显示 "错误:拒绝访问" 消息。
-
原因:用户名或密码不正确。
-
解决方案:检查您的凭据,确保输入正确。
2. 服务器配置错误
-
错误:在连接到服务器时显示 "无法连接到 MySQL 服务器" 消息。
-
原因:服务器配置错误,如防火墙限制或错误的数据库端口。
-
解决方案:检查服务器防火墙设置,确保它允许来自 phpMyAdmin 安装的连接。如果端口不正确,请在 phpMyAdmin 配置中更正它。
3. 权限问题
-
错误:在访问数据库时显示 "您没有访问权限" 消息。
-
原因:用户没有足够的权限访问该数据库。
-
解决方案:检查数据库的权限设置,确保用户被授予正确的权限。
4. 会话超时
-
错误:操作时显示 "会话已超时" 消息。
-
原因:会话超时,导致与服务器的连接断开。
-
解决方案:刷新浏览器页面以重新建立连接。
5. phpMyAdmin 配置错误
-
错误:在访问 phpMyAdmin 时显示 "拒绝访问" 或 "403 禁止" 消息。
-
原因: phpMyAdmin 配置不正确,如错误的文件权限或缺少必要的 Apache 模块。
-
解决方案:检查 phpMyAdmin 的配置文件和文件权限。确保它具有正确的权限,并且启用了必要的 Apache 模块,例如 mod_rewrite。
6. 服务器问题
-
错误:在尝试连接到服务器时显示 "连接失败" 消息。
-
原因:服务器不可用或出现临时问题。
-
解决方案:等待一段时间后重试。如果问题持续存在,请联系您的主机提供商。
以上是为什么phpmyadmin拒绝访问的详细内容。更多信息请关注PHP中文网其他相关文章!